## Who to ping about GiftNote

Welcome aboard! GiftNote is our donation-receipt mailer for the Larchfield Fund. Template tweaks go to the comms folks; delivery failures and bounce weirdness go to the platform crew. Don't push template changes on Fridays — receipts batch over the weekend. For anything GiftNote-related, start with the address below.

billing contact of kaweg-tajeg = drudor.lamion.oliath@torvalabs.test

## Capacity note: AddressZip autocomplete

Heads up, support folks — AddressZip's autocomplete widget is getting hammered since the Larkmont retail launch. We're provisioning two more lookup shards and tightening per-session rate limits, so a few chatty clients may see throttle messages. If customers ask, the behavior is intentional. The limits now in effect are listed below.

tuning table, yajog-yahof:
BUDGETS = {
    "lamvan": 303,
    "wenox": 460,
    "fenvan": 525,
}

14:22 — Support began receiving tickets that grouped totals in the Marlowe Report Builder shifted between exports. Engineering at Tindervale confirmed the new sort pass was not stable: rows with equal keys were reordered nondeterministically, so identical reports rendered differently per run. 14:51 — A stable merge sort was restored behind a flag and exports were replayed for affected customers. No data was lost; only row order within tied groups changed. The fix shipped in the hotfix build identified by the trace token below.

pipeline stamp: htk3_69f

The garage occupancy feed for the Brindlewood campus arrives over a message queue every thirty seconds, one record per level, published by the Stallgrid edge boxes. Counts can briefly go negative when a sensor double-fires on exit; the ingest job clamps these to zero and flags the interval. If the feed stalls for more than five minutes, the dashboard falls back to the last known snapshot. Sensor mappings, queue names, and the replay procedure are documented on the internal page below.

runbook for tahog-kadug: https://gitlab.qirvanworks.corp/projects/pages/view/b139298aed28